"I'm really disappointed. It's not the way you expect it to end. You'd like to walk off into the sunset and let it be your decision. But I've got a lot to be thankful for. I've called three Super Bowl championships, 498 consecutive games over 25 years and it was a great run. I'm still a good broadcaster. If I want to find another play-by-play job, I'd like to think someone might want to hire me." -- Frank Herzog
